Hardness is a characteristic value that indicates resistance to partial deformation or abrasion of the material surface. It is easyto measure, and data can quickly be obtained. It also shows correlation with mechanical properties, such as tensile strength. Al2O3/SiC composite with three concentrations of silicon carbide was sintered, and heat-treated at three differenttemperatures. The Vickers hardness of the as-received specimen and the heat-treatment specimen was analyzed by Weibullstatistics, and its probability distribution characteristics were evaluated. Since an oxide layer was formed on the surface bythe heat-treatment, the hardness of the specimen having high temperature heat-treatment was low. The shape parameter andthe mean Vickers hardness decreased as the heat-treatment temperature increased, and the scale parameters showed smallerthan those of the as-received specimen. The scale parameters of the 1,473 K specimen were larger than those of the as-receivedspecimen, but those of the (1,573 and the 1,673) K specimens were smaller than those of the as-received specimen. The entireshape parameters, except for the 1,673 K specimen of AS15Y3, were smaller than those of the as-received specimen, and thedispersions were large.
